advantages and disadvantages of paging and segmentationhetch hetchy dam pros and cons

But in systems running OS there is no other way than paging. In segmentation, the operating system maintains a list of holes present in the main memory. Pages are simple to share. It does not effect from fragmentation. Advantages of Paging and Segmentation Disadvantages of Paging and Segmentation Paging No external fragmentation Segments can grow without any reshuffling Can run process when some pages are swapped to disk Increases flexibility of sharing Segmentation Supports sparse address spaces - Decreases size of page tables Define the terms Paging, Segmentation, and Swapping in the context of operating system II. more efficient swapping. No internal fragmentation on updated OS's. Frames do not have to be contiguous. This tutorial explains user about paging vs. segmentation, the definitions of paging and segmentation in os, and how to explain segmentation with . Disadvantages of Segmented Paging. 2. Figure: segmentation os operating system advantages examples. Paging is a simple memory management approach that is believed to be effective. The segment table is of lesser size when compared to the page table in paging. 13. . (pagination and segmentation) Compare the memory management systems of Windows (recent versions, after Win 2000) and Linux from the pagination/segmentation point of view. The paging systems enable interaction with members though the device requires big transmitted powers as a way of kilowatts. It makes memory allocations simpler. People living in the same region can have different requirements. In fact, some architectures provide both. It is costly. Each segment is in turn broken up into a number of fixed-size pages which are equal in length to a main memory frame. The operating system is in charge of paging. We will also discuss segmentation using an example and conclude the discussion with some advantages and disadvantages. Concept of paging is totally hidden to the user. Segmentation is slower than paging. Login to Answer. Disadvantage of Segmentation At the time of swapping, processes are loaded and removed from the main memory, then the free memory space is broken into small . 2. Advantages of Segmented Paging. Advantages and Disadvantages of Paging. we can know everything which is happening in the world. work-application-japan. If, any program is larger to physical memory then It helps to run this program. Paged Segmentation Advantages & Disadvantages -Operating System | OS Lectures ER. It's ideal in sending short messages that are extremely used by subscribers. Advantages of Segmentation There is no internal fragmentation. ! Segment table has only one entry corresponding to one actual segment. The partitions of the secondary memory are called pages while the partitions of the main memory are called frames. Segment 1 is stored on address 11. Additional memory consumption by Page tables. Paging; Segmentation; Paging. hur mnga svenskar har 10 miljoner. Segment 2 is of 100KB. in a very system victimisation Disadvantages or Limitations of Market Segmentation. Frame number Advantages of Paging Listed below are advantages of paging: The paging technique is easy to implement. May save memory if segments are very small and should not be combined into one page. Answer (1 of 4): Memory paging is not used in microcontrollers or such smaller systems where only one (or few controlled) program is running. Otherwise, the . It reduces memory usage. The logical address consists of two parts: a segment number (s) and an offset (d) into that segment. Lends itself to sharing data among processes. 1. A page can be bound to one or more frame page ( keep in mind that a page can map different frame pages, but just one at the time) Advantages and Disadvantages. Paging is simple to implement and assumed as an efficient memory management technique. Segment 3 is of 60KB. It is more useful in time sharing system. Segments referencing multiple processes can help achieve sharing. you'll also get a segmentation fault if you try to access memory beyond the bounds of that segment. hus till salu viby sollentuna May 29, 2022; No Comments; nina hart gary cause of death unika festlokaler stockholm, bpsd bemtandeplan exempel, vilket brnsle pverkar vxthuseffekten minst; lejebolig viborg kommune Paging: Paging is a method or techniques which is used for non-contiguous memory allocation. Disadvantages of Segmentation. Here is a list of advantages and disadvantages of paging . External Fragmentation is not there. Paging is a non-contiguous memory allocation technique in which secondary memory and the main memory is divided into equal size partitions. Concept of segmentation is visible to the user. Author: vaishali bhatia. The main aim of medical image segmentation is to study anatomical structure, identify regions of interest, measures tissue volume to measure tumor growth. However, the probability of external fragmentation occurring is significantly less. Hola there Advantages And Disadvantages Of Paging And Segmentation Computer Science Essay. Disadvantages of network segmentation. hus till salu viby sollentuna May 29, 2022; No Comments; nina hart gary cause of death unika festlokaler stockholm, bpsd bemtandeplan exempel, vilket brnsle pverkar vxthuseffekten minst; lejebolig viborg kommune Segmentation gives a memory-management scheme that increases the support of the user's perspective on memory.A user program can be subdivided using a segmentation scheme, in which the program and the . Paging reduces external fragmentation, but still suffer from internal fragmentation. Advantages and Disadvantages Of Segmentation. It reduces memory usage. Disadvantages- The disadvantages of segmented paging are- Paging reduces external fragmentation, but still suffer from internal fragmentation. It simplifies memory allocations. we can send e - mail faster across the universe which maintail a good relationship. Segmentation What are the advantages / disadvantages of each of them? between land fragmentation and . The segment table is of lesser size compared with the page table in paging. ADVANTAGES OF SEGMENTATION No internal fragmentation Segment tables consume less memory than page tables ( only one entry per actual segment as opposed to one entry per page in Paging method) Because of the small segment table, memory reference is easy. If a segment is less than a page in length, the segment occupies just one page. In this section, we discuss the Intel Pentium architecture, which supports both pure segmentation and segmentation with paging. If offset is beyond the end of the segment, we trap the Operating System. Explain any FOUR advantages of each of the following: 1. Sometimes, market segmentation becomes an expensive proposition. Easy to share all pages. Disadvantages:- In a broad area paging technique, a paging management facility can be purchased which connects the PSTN to various paging terminals. This causes for a very big lack of diversity among the population of these organisms. Explain any FOUR disadvantages of each of the following:. It does not create external fragmentation because it allocates fixed-size pages. Here is a list of advantages and disadvantages of paging . between land fragmentation and . We do not give a complete description of the memory-management structure of the . There are some advantages and disadvantages of variable partitioning over fixed partitioning as given below. Due to equal size of the pages and frames, swapping becomes very easy. 12. Segment tables: only one entry per actual segment as opposed to one per page in VM. No internal fragmentation; As compared to paging, segment tables use lesser memory. This article extensively discussed Segmented Paging and its advantages and disadvantages. The concept of segmentation in os is similar to paging which is used for memory management. 2.1. Partition management is more simply. Gives a programmers view along with the advantages of paging. Swapping III. leann hunley kinder. Segmentation. The main aim of medical image segmentation is to study anatomical structure, identify regions of interest, measures tissue volume to measure tumor growth. A segment is considered a logical unit of information. Reduces external fragmentation in comparison with segmentation. It is a fixed size partitioning theme (scheme). Advantages and Disadvantages. Conclusion. 11. Swapping is simple due to the identical size of the pages and frames. Advantages And Disadvantages Of Paging And Segmentation Computer Science . Segmentation And Paging For HCTM Kaithal Presented By : Madhur Gupta 1712159 CSE A 5th Sem ( 2012-2016) . Ans: Example: The Intel Pentium Both paging and segmentation have advantages and disadvantages. The paging technique supports non-contiguous memory allocation Disadvantages of Paging But let's start with problem. Each page in paging has a fixed size, while segments have a variable size. Though market segmentation offers a lot of advantages, it has some limitations with respect to cost and market coverage. Segment Table is used to record the segments and it consumes less space in comparison to the Page table in paging. What are advantages of demand paging? Memory can be utilized with better efficiently. It always ensures the efficient and effective use of the main memory space. There is less overhead in segmentation; It is very much simpler to relocate segments than entire address space. Physical Memory-Total memory of the computer. In this way, memory is spited into different small blocks with near about 4 KB in size, and these blocks are known as Paging Files. Disadvantages of Segmentation in OS. Here are the pros/benefits of Segmentation: Simple to relocate segments than the entire address space. Now-a-days, segmentation has attained a high degree of sophistication. Advantages and Disadvantages of Paging. Since it allocates fixed-size pages, it doesn't cause external fragmentation. 4b) With the aid of diagrams, explain the differences between internal memory fragmentation and external memory fragmentation Question : 4a) Explain clearly the differences between paging and segmentation of memory. Paging. No internal fragmentation. Paging divides the virtual memory into pieces called "pages" and also divides the physical memory into pieces called "frame pages". Paging is simple to implement and assumed as an efficient memory management technique. The absence of internal fragmentation as external fragmentation has to be done. People living in the same region can have different requirements. In a combined paging/segmentation system a user address space is broken up into a number of segments at the discretion of the programmer. Memory reference overhead due to multi-level paging. The biggest advantage of paging is that it is easy to use memory management algorithm Paging may cause Internal fragmentation Segmentation method works almost similarly to paging, only difference between the two is that segments are of variable-length whereas, in the paging method, pages are always of fixed size. Size of segment 1 is 50KB. What about segmentation? We have to right for scaling of virtual memory. In paging, both main memory and secondary memory are divided into equal fixed size partitions. We briefly discussed segmentation and paging as well. Segmentation divides the user program and the data associated with the program into the number of segments. disadvantages of segmentation. Each segment is actually a different logical address space of the program. The paging technique makes efficient utilization of memory. Allocating memory is simple and inexpensive. helpful games give mind relaxation. Average segment size >> average page size. disadvantages of segmentationmarlo mike family killed in baton rouge. It is costly. Segmentation in OS. disadvantages of segmentation . In this example, the process is divided into three segments. Internal Fragmentation will be there. Advantages of segmentation in OS. online toutoring. There absence of internal fragmentation, because external fragmentation has to be done. Advantages: Paging is transparent to programmers, and therefore it eliminates the requirement of external fragmentation. . Paging Disadvantages Paging causes internal fragmentation on older systems. . Segmentation is a way to divide the user program and data into segments. Even in a time of decreasing physical memory costs, contemporary computers devote considerable resources to supporting virtual address spaces that are much larger than the physical memory allocated to a process. Page table size is limited by the segment size. The offset d of the logical address must be between 0 and the segment limit. No compaction is necessary. Segmentation. Simplicity in partitioning (non-contiguous memory allocation). The partitions of secondary memory area unit and main memory area unit known as as pages and frames respectively. 1. Segmentation: 3. Less overhead. say making one segment only writable by process 'a'. Each segment is actually a different logical address space of the program. Disadvantages of Segmentation. The main drawback is external fragmentation. 3. In terms of memory access, paging is faster than segmentation. There are some advantages and disadvantages of variable partitioning over fixed partitioning as given below. The following is a list of the advantages and disadvantages of paging. Disadvantages of Paging Internal fragmentation (only at the last page of the process). Otherwise, the . The fundamental advantage of segmented paging is that it uses less memory. Disadvantages of Segmented Paging Internal fragmentation still exists in pages. paging is a vital a part of computer memory implementation in most modern all-purpose operative systems, permitting them to use disk storage for knowledge that doesn't work into physical random-access memory (ram).segmentation is that the division of a computer's primary memory into segments or sections. Operating Systems. Lends itself to protection. Also discuss its advantages and disadvantages. It simplifies memory allocation. 5 advantages of computer and 5 disadvantage of computer. The size of Page Table is limited by the segment size. segmentation is the process of dividing memory into chunks and generally defining access restrictions on those chunks . Segmentation is a memory management technique in which each job is divided into several segments of different sizes, one for each module that contains pieces that perform related functions. Since the entire segment need not be swapped out, the swapping out into virtual memory becomes easier . Segmentation is a memory management technique in which each job is divided into several segments of different sizes, one for each module that contains pieces that perform related functions. 2. Segmentation is similar to paging, except that the length of segments is variable and pages have a fixed size. if process 'b' tries to write to that memory segment, you'll get a segmentation fault. Advantages and Disadvantages of Paging. Q2. The paging technique supports time-sharing system. Today you will learn Segmentation in OS: Hardware Architecture, Need, Advantages, Disadvantages with example and a short assignment that you have to submit via email to info@yuvayana.org. What are the advantages and disadvantages of each scheme? Segmentation Hardware. say trying to read from address 4 . Extra hardware is required In paging, the logical address space is . Paging and Segmentation: Advantages and Disadvantages Paging Advantages On the programmer level, paging is a transparent function and does not require intervention. EX . Segmentation and paging are two different things. it helps to improve our knowledge. Advantages And Disadvantages Of Paging And Segmentation Computer Science . Consider you have 2 programs running on single CPU having singl. Disadvantages of network segmentation. disadvantages of segmentationmarlo mike family killed in baton rouge. Advantages and Disadvantages The main advantage of segmented paging is the memory usage reduction. A program is divided into variable size segments. What about supporting both pagination; Question: Pagination vs. . Advantages and Disadvantages of Paging. Here is a list of advantages and disadvantages of paging . Segment 2 is stored on address 13. The paging is enabled with using the page table, which is help out to translate the virtual addresses for using operating system and other running other applications, and they use those addresses into physical addresses which are used by MMU. Advantages and Disadvantages of Paging. Found insidePaging is a method of non-contiguous memory allocation. It solves the problem of external fragmentation. Advantages and Disadvantages Advantages : Allocating memory is easy and cheap Any free page is ok, OS can take first one out of list it keeps Eliminates external fragmentation Data (page frames) can be scattered all over PM Pages are mapped appropriately anyway Allows demand paging and prepaging More efficient swapping Advantages- The advantages of segmented paging are-Segment table contains only one entry corresponding to each segment. Segmentation, and 3. Here is a list of advantages and disadvantages of paging . They are divided into equal size partitions to have maximum . it is not good for eye site. Advantages of Demand Paging. Advantages and Disadvantages Advantages : Allocating memory is easy and cheap Any free page is ok, OS can take first one out of list it keeps Eliminates external fragmentation Data (page frames) can be scattered all over PM Pages are mapped appropriately anyway Allows demand paging and prepaging More efficient swapping Answer Added!! Disadvantages of Paging in OS. Deepak GargAdvantages-The advantages of segmented paging are-1) Segment tab. The average size of the segment is larger to the actual size of the page External fragmentation is reduced by paging, but internal fragmentation remains. Contents InThe Presentation Memory Segmentation Segmentation Hardware Advantages Disadvantages Paging Frames Mapping Combining Segmentation with Paging 3. Following are the disadvantages of paging in Operating System: Internal fragmentation. Found inside - Page 88Advantages: Paging supports the time sharing system. Following are the disadvantages of . Well, there is a difference between paging and segmentation in paging each page has an equivalent fixed size whereas segments are of variable size. Due to equal size of the pages and frames, swapping becomes very easy. A page is considered a physical unit of information. no external fragmentation. No need of compaction. Advantages. . Segmentation is the responsibility of the user/compiler. Following are the advantages of segmentation: Provides protection within segments. Paging. No external fragmentation. The segment number used as an index into the segment table. This causes for a very big lack of diversity among the population of these organisms.